Office rents break record; cross ₹100 per square foot
There has been a strong surge in the country’s office market. In the first quarter of 2026, the average office rent crossed ₹100 per square foot for the first time. After the pandemic, vacancy rates in eight major cities have fallen to 13.85%. In several areas of Bengaluru and Mumbai, it has now become difficult […]

Property purchase becomes doubly expensive: Along with prices, construction rates also increased
Average increase of 26% at 2,625 locations in Indore Indore: Buying a house in the state is now becoming more expensive than before. The Central Valuation Board has approved the new Collector Guideline Rates for 2026–27, which will come into effect from April 1.
